Tortilla soup is a chicken soup variety served with tortillas.



There are claims that this soup originated from the southwest as a way to use old tortillas. It might be true, but I will attest that this does not taste like any old tortilla at all. In fact, this soup is very flavorful and fresh tasting.
This soup has is a bit spicy because of the Jalapeno. It is best served during the cold seasons. I also find this rich and comforting –maybe because of the avocado and cheese.

Tortilla Soup Recipe


Ingredients:


2 cups chicken, cooked and shredded
1 medium avocado (ripe), peeled and sliced
Corn tortilla strips
1 piece jalapeno pepper, sliced crosswise
1 can diced tomatoes (about 15 ounces)
5 cups chicken broth
1 teaspoon salt
1/2 cup cilantro, chopped
2 pieces lime, sliced into wedges
1/4 cup sharp cheddar cheese
1 tablespoon olive oil
1 medium onion, chopped
2 teaspoons garlic, minced


Cooking Procedure:


Heat a cooking pot and pour-in oil.
Put-in onion when the oil becomes hot. Cook until soft.
Add garlic and jalapeno.
Put-in tomatoes and cook for a minute.
Add chicken broth and let boil.Simmer for 10 minutes.
Put the shredded chicken and salt. Simmer for 12 minutes.
Turn the heat off and transfer to a serving bowl.
Add cilantro, tortilla strips, sliced avocado, and cheese.
Serve with lime. Share and enjoy!
